A ceremony to mark the departure on a Sewol pilgrimage, from a pier in Incheon to Paengmok Port in Jindo, South Jeolla Province (a distance of 806.16km, over 53 days), May 15. Around 200 people are participating, including Sewol bereaved families, Ven. Jaeseung (leader of the Jogye Order of Buddhism), and members of civic, religious, artistic and cultural groups. Jeong Bu-ja, mother of Shin Ho-sung, a Danwon High School boy who died in the Sewol sinking, said, “The government should make the country healthier and safer for our sons and daughters.” (provided by Incheon Solidarity for Peace and Welfare)

 

On May 16, 27 more human bones were found in the Sewol’s third level, raising bereaved families‘ expectations that their loved ones’ remains will be identified.
